Top Tips for Designing Intuitive User Interfaces
Creating a user-friendly and intuitive interface is crucial for ensuring a positive user experience. A well-designed interface can increase user satisfaction, engagement, and adoption rates. In this article, we will share some top tips for designing intuitive user interfaces using HTML.
Understanding Intuitive User Interfaces
Before we jump into the tips, it's essential to understand what intuitive design is. Intuitive design is a user interface design that allows users to accomplish their tasks quickly and efficiently, without any frustration. An intuitive interface doesn't require users to think about what they're doing; instead, it guides them through the process of completing their goals.
Defining Intuitive Design
Intuitive design is more than just creating an attractive interface; it's about understanding your users and providing them with an interface that meets their needs. An intuitive interface is simple and easy to use, with no unnecessary complexity or confusion. It provides clear information and feedback to users at each step of their interaction with the interface.
One way to achieve intuitive design is by conducting user research. By understanding your users' needs, behaviors, and pain points, you can design an interface that addresses their specific needs. For example, if you're designing an e-commerce website, you might discover that users are frustrated with the checkout process. By simplifying the checkout process and providing clear instructions, you can create a more intuitive interface.
Another important aspect of intuitive design is consistency. Users should be able to navigate your interface without having to relearn how to use it each time they visit. Consistency in design elements such as buttons, menus, and fonts can help users feel more comfortable and confident in their interactions with your interface.
The Importance of Intuitive UI in User Experience
An intuitive interface is essential for a positive user experience. Users who encounter difficulty navigating an app or website are more likely to abandon it and choose a competitor instead. A confusing user interface can lead to frustration, negative feedback, and possible loss of business. Therefore, it's crucial to prioritize intuitive design in your interface.
Intuitive UI can also lead to increased user engagement and satisfaction. When users can easily accomplish their tasks and find what they're looking for, they're more likely to return to your app or website in the future. Intuitive design can also help build brand loyalty and trust, as users associate positive experiences with your brand.
Finally, intuitive design can have a positive impact on your bottom line. By reducing user frustration and increasing engagement, you can improve conversion rates and revenue. Investing in intuitive design can be a smart business decision that pays off in the long run.
Know Your Users
Before designing intuitive UI, you need to know your users well. By understanding your target audience, you can design an interface that meets their expectations and goals. Two effective ways of getting to know your users are conducting user research and creating user personas.
Conducting User Research
User research involves gathering qualitative and quantitative data to understand user behavior, needs, and pain points. Conducting user research allows you to identify opportunities to improve the user experience, streamline tasks, and increase user engagement.
One effective way to conduct user research is by using surveys. Surveys allow you to gather data from a large number of users quickly and efficiently. You can use tools like SurveyMonkey or Google Forms to create and distribute surveys to your target audience. Additionally, you can conduct user interviews to gain a deeper understanding of user behavior and needs. User interviews allow you to ask follow-up questions and gather more detailed information than surveys.
Creating User Personas
User personas are fictional representations of your target users based on research and data. User personas help you understand your users' needs, goals, and behaviors while interacting with your interface. By using user personas, you can design an interface tailored to your specific target audience.
When creating user personas, it's essential to consider factors like age, gender, occupation, education level, and interests. You can use tools like Xtensio or Persona.ly to create user personas quickly and easily. Once you have created your user personas, you can use them as a reference when designing your UI. By keeping your user personas in mind, you can ensure that your interface meets the needs and expectations of your target audience.
Understanding User Goals and Expectations
Understanding user goals and expectations is crucial for designing an intuitive interface. By analyzing users' goals and expectations, you can design an interface with clear and necessary elements that help users achieve their objectives.
One effective way to understand user goals and expectations is by conducting usability testing. Usability testing involves observing users as they interact with your interface and gathering feedback on their experience. You can use tools like UserTesting or Hotjar to conduct usability testing and gather feedback from your target audience. By analyzing the results of usability testing, you can identify areas where your interface can be improved to better meet the needs of your users.
Overall, knowing your users is essential for designing an intuitive and user-friendly interface. By conducting user research, creating user personas, and understanding user goals and expectations, you can design an interface that meets the needs and expectations of your target audience.
Implementing Consistency and Standards
Consistency is key to an intuitive interface. When designing your interface, ensure that you use consistent design elements throughout. This consistency helps users understand how to interact with the interface and reduces cognitive load. Consistency also assures users that they are on the right path and provides a sense of familiarity.
Consistency in design elements is not only limited to button sizes, colors, and fonts. It also extends to the placement and alignment of these elements. For example, if you place the search bar in the top right corner of the page on one page, it should be placed in the same position on all other pages. This consistency in placement helps users locate the search bar easily, regardless of which page they are on.
Consistent Design Elements
Consistent design elements include button sizes, colors, and fonts. The consistency in your interface should be maintained across all pages or sections to create a sense of cohesiveness and clarity. Use HTML tags to maintain uniformity in the design elements throughout.
Another important aspect of consistency is the use of language. Ensure that the language used in your interface is consistent throughout. For example, if you use the term "add to cart" on one page, use the same term on all other pages instead of using "buy now" or "add to bag". This consistency in language helps users understand the actions they are taking and reduces confusion.
Adhering to Platform Guidelines
When designing for a specific platform, such as iOS or Android, it's vital to follow the platform's guidelines. These guidelines ensure that your interface is consistent with other native apps, making it more intuitive for users. The guidelines also include recommended design elements for that specific platform, making it easier to design the interface.
Adhering to platform guidelines not only ensures consistency but also helps your application blend in with other apps on the platform. This can help users feel more comfortable using your app, as it feels like a natural extension of the platform they are already familiar with.
Utilizing Familiar Patterns and Interactions
Designing an interface that uses familiar interaction patterns and habits can help make your application feel more user-friendly. Users are often more likely to continue using an interface that feels familiar and comfortable. By utilizing familiar interaction patterns and habits, you can make users feel more comfortable and intuitive.
For example, if you are designing an e-commerce website, users are likely familiar with the shopping cart icon. Using this icon to represent the shopping cart in your interface can help users quickly understand its purpose and reduce the learning curve.
In conclusion, consistency and standards are vital to creating an intuitive and user-friendly interface. By maintaining consistency in design elements, language, and placement, adhering to platform guidelines, and utilizing familiar patterns and interactions, you can create an interface that is easy to use and understand.
Prioritizing Clarity and Simplicity
An intuitive interface should prioritize clarity and simplicity. These design elements reduce cognitive load and make it easier for users to interact with the interface. When designing an interface, it is essential to understand that users should be able to understand the interface's available options at a glance, making it easier for them to navigate. The interface should be designed in such a way that it is easy to use, and users can accomplish their objectives without any hassle.
One way to prioritize clarity and simplicity is to use a minimalistic design approach. A minimalistic design approach focuses on removing any unnecessary elements from the interface. This approach ensures that the interface is kept clean and straightforward, making it more comfortable for users to navigate.
Clear Visual Hierarchy
A clear visual hierarchy ensures that users can easily navigate the interface's elements. Design elements that need to be more visible and prominent should stand out to users while designing the interface. The use of HTML tags for headings and subheadings can help maintain a clear visual hierarchy throughout the interface.
Another way to maintain a clear visual hierarchy is to use contrasting colors. Contrasting colors help to differentiate between different elements on the interface, making it easier for users to identify and interact with them. For example, using a bright color for a call-to-action button can help it stand out from the rest of the interface's elements.
Minimizing Cognitive Load
Cognitive load refers to everything a user needs to remember to complete their objectives. To minimize cognitive load, remove the irrelevant or unnecessary design elements. This ensures that the interface is kept clean and straightforward, making it more comfortable for users to navigate.
Another way to reduce cognitive load is to use consistent design elements throughout the interface. Consistent design elements help users to understand how the interface works and what they need to do to accomplish their objectives. For example, using the same button style throughout the interface can help users identify which elements are clickable.
Reducing Unnecessary Elements
An intuitive interface should only include essential elements. By eliminating unnecessary elements, your design will be more straightforward, and users can accomplish their goals with ease. This approach also reduces cognitive overload on users by reducing the amount of information they need to process.
When designing an interface, it is essential to consider the user's objectives and remove any elements that do not contribute to achieving those objectives. For example, if the user's objective is to complete a form, there is no need to include any distracting elements that may take their attention away from the form.
In conclusion, prioritizing clarity and simplicity is essential when designing an intuitive interface. By maintaining a clear visual hierarchy, minimizing cognitive load, and reducing unnecessary elements, you can create an interface that is easy to use and helps users achieve their objectives with ease.
An intuitive user interface is critical for ensuring a positive user experience. By following these tips, you can design an interface that meets your users' expectations and goals while reducing cognitive overload. By implementing consistency and simplicity, you can create a user-friendly interface and increase engagement and adoption rates.